About Dudley Park 6210

The size of Dudley Park is approximately 11.1 square kilometres. It has 24 parks covering nearly 4.9% of total area. The population of Dudley Park in 2011 was 5,751 people. By 2016 the population was 6,232 showing a population growth of 8.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Dudley Park is 60-69 years. Households in Dudley Park are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Dudley Park work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 64.9% of the homes in Dudley Park were owner-occupied compared with 70.4% in 2016.

Dudley Park has 4,034 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Dudley Park have seen a 95.45%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 120.93% increase. As at 31 July 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Dudley Park is $675,996 while the median value for Units is $394,215.
  • Houses have a median rent of $550 while Units have a median rent of $500.
